Output 893cbd592e34bb50ae7b6364b1025f7eecbea1b43fac53b4951a07f8b73cb307:1

value
12055176
script pubkey
OP_0 OP_PUSHBYTES_20 bc1a5c8243fb34c1478a3539c7074c3e13194467
address
ltc1qhsd9eqjrlv6vz3u2x5uuwp6v8cf3j3r8268e6v
transaction
893cbd592e34bb50ae7b6364b1025f7eecbea1b43fac53b4951a07f8b73cb307
spent
true